James "jaybo" Baker
Lovingly memorialized by MAKALA BAKER on February 29, 2016
Mr. James"jaybo" Baker was born to the late Mr. Christopher Baker and Mrs. Xandra Baker on July 24th 1984 in Laurens county . He is a graduate of Treutlen county High school and Clayton state university of Atlanta Ga.
James accepted Jesus Christ as his personal savior in 1998. He was a member of Mt. Olive Baptist church of Lithonia Ga. He was united in Holy Matrimony to Melissa Baker and to this union God blessed them with Two young boys .
He departed his life on February 21, 2016 at the age of 32 in a fatal vehicle accident along with his 8 year old son James Baker Jr. James "jaybo" Baker leaves a legacy of fond memories to two children the late James Baker Jr of Charlotte South Carolina and Jalick Baker of Lithonia Ga . James was blessed with 3 sisters through his life. Makala Baker , Alexis Baker , and Kennedy johnson all of Soperton Ga.
James leaves two precious Grandmothers Bernice Brown and Lillian Baker both of soperton Ga. He was blessed a host of Aunts, Uncles, Nieces, Nephews, Cousins, and Countless friends.

Louise McCafferty
Lovingly memorialized by Elizabeth McCafferty on February 27, 2016
Louise was a woman who loved many things in her long life. She always cherished the time she spent with her children and grandchildren through decades of motorcycle racing, horse shows and sports. She was a devoted employee of Villa Fairmont where enjoyed helping her clients. She was a huge animal lover, from big to small, she loved them all. She was genrous to a fault and always helped those who asked even if it was to her detriment.
We will remember the good times, we will miss you and love you always.

Cheri Lynn Opper
Lovingly memorialized by Nikki Opper on February 26, 2016
In loving memory of Cheri Lynn Opper. Cheri was a kind hearted animal lover. Her passion for animal welfare lead her to publish her own newspaper called Animal Adventures among her many accomplishments. Cheri always put other peoples needs before her own. She is missed dearly by her Husband, Daughter and many friends.
Can't believe it has been a year since we have seen your beautiful smile and heard your infectious laugh. You were the light in our lives. Not a day goes by we don't think of you. All our love!!
